Ru-Board.club
← Вернуться в раздел «Программы»

» FreeArc: бесплатный open-source архиватор - Часть 2

Автор: DemonAk
Дата сообщения: 02.06.2009 18:23

Цитата:
как сказал Егор, с помощью lt. плюс нужен arc.ini. то что я привёл - полный набор, подходящий для любых архивов, созданных с -max

Понял, в моем случае нужны только эти вроде: precomp04.exe, PPMonstr.exe, packjpg_dll.dll, arc.ini, но все равно хотелось бы как нибудь чтобы информация выводилась какой конкретно использовался файл, для precomp'a precomp04.exe и т.д, если конечно это возможно.

Bulat_Ziganshin, egor23
Спасибо огромное за помощь
Автор: Bulat_Ziganshin
Дата сообщения: 02.06.2009 20:21

Цитата:
хотелось бы как нибудь чтобы информация выводилась какой конкретно использовался файл, для precomp'a precomp04.exe и т.д, если конечно это возможно.

это довольно сложэно, так что в ближайшее время не планируется. включай просто все указанные мной файлы при использовании -max


да, народ, насчёт context menu - вас устраивает текст, показываемый в меню и в строке подсказки (help)? хотелось бы устаканить это прежде чем включать перевод. моджет, там где-то надо имя архива добавить и всё такое
Автор: Nick222
Дата сообщения: 02.06.2009 21:01
Bulat_Ziganshin
А как там с результатом по моим файлам - когда примерно будет исправление?
Автор: juvaforza
Дата сообщения: 02.06.2009 21:43
Nick222
Issue 80
Автор: Bulat_Ziganshin
Дата сообщения: 02.06.2009 21:53
Nick222
думаю в течении недели. а что за спешка? если тебе надо все файлы в каталоге сархивировать, так нажми Add, ничего не выделяя
Автор: Nick222
Дата сообщения: 02.06.2009 22:27
Bulat_Ziganshin
Спешки нет, просто пытаюсь понять типичные темпы ситуации.
Автор: DemonAk
Дата сообщения: 03.06.2009 00:11
Bulat_Ziganshin
Почему то параметр -w не работает, либо он работает не так. Архив (test.arc) создан с precomp. Начинаю распаковывать, а темповские файлы создаются рядом с архивом =(. Я то думал темпы будут создаваться в %Temp%.
Автор: Bulat_Ziganshin
Дата сообщения: 03.06.2009 00:23
я же сказал выше, что это не работает ни для sfx, ни для самого arc. -w сейчас используется только для создания самого архива
Автор: egor23
Дата сообщения: 04.06.2009 14:06
Bulat_Ziganshin
поставил Win7 7100 x86 на VirtualBox
посмотрел на dll-ки всё красиво, все системные dll-ки, где-то там за 0x70000000
может dll-ки FreeArc-а по плотней сгруппировать с помошью ReBase.Exe?
например:
dll-ки из bin\ и lib\
REBASE.EXE -b 0x6c000000 *.dll
или
REBASE.EXE -b 0x6c000000 @files.txt
а то крамсают блок в 200МБ-256МБ...
Автор: Bulat_Ziganshin
Дата сообщения: 04.06.2009 14:08
а конкретно предложить можешь? все на 6c?
Автор: egor23
Дата сообщения: 04.06.2009 14:15
Bulat_Ziganshin

Цитата:
а конкретно предложить можешь? все на 6c?

это и есть конкретное предложение
ReBase.Exe сдвигает сам базовые адреса, в примере указан базовый адрес который будет у перовй dll-ки, а дальше автоматом присваивается.
Автор: Bulat_Ziganshin
Дата сообщения: 04.06.2009 14:21
ok, перебазировал весь gtk:

C:\!\FreeArchiver\Installer\GTK>"C:\Program Files\Microsoft SDKs\Windows\v6.0A\Bin\REBASE.EXE" -b 0x6c000000 @dlls
REBASE: *** RelocateImage failed (xmlparse.dll). Image may be corrupted
REBASE: *** RelocateImage failed (xmltok.dll). Image may be corrupted

REBASE: Total Size of mapping 0x0000000000b80000
REBASE: Range 0x000000006c000000 -0x000000006cb80000

счас соберу инсталлер. попробуешь?

Добавлено:
http://www.haskell.org/bz/FreeArc-portable-0.52-win32.arc
Автор: egor23
Дата сообщения: 04.06.2009 14:35
посмотрю


Цитата:
Bin\REBASE.EXE" -b 0x6c000000 @dlls

не все dll-ки...
в lib\ ещё есть
Автор: Bulat_Ziganshin
Дата сообщения: 04.06.2009 14:39
я поправил все gtk-шные. путь к самому rebase здесь не при чём
Автор: egor23
Дата сообщения: 04.06.2009 15:20
Bulat_Ziganshin

Цитата:
посмотрю

посмотрел WinXP SP2\ WinXP SP2 x64 \ Win7 7100 x86, работает.
осталось посмотреть на Win7 7100 x64, но у меня нет такой возможности сейчас.
единственное что лучше facompress.dll разместить рядом с FreeArc.exe (куда точно не скажу)
или на откуп системе оставить, как было до этого (0x00400000).
это полезно будет для Arc.exe

с папкой ini\ закончено? или какая логика работы с ней?
Автор: Bulat_Ziganshin
Дата сообщения: 04.06.2009 17:13

Цитата:
с папкой ini\ закончено? или какая логика работы с ней?

это ошибка, исправлю
Автор: Bulat_Ziganshin
Дата сообщения: 05.06.2009 13:54
arc1 updated: added Add../Extract.../Modify.../Join... commands to Explorer context menu
Автор: crotoff
Дата сообщения: 05.06.2009 14:35
Good job
Автор: egor23
Дата сообщения: 05.06.2009 16:54
Bulat_Ziganshin
FreeArc

Распаковать
не хватает опций в явном виде:
Перезапись:
Переименовывать автом.
Переим. автом. сушеств.

соответственно нужны и опции при распаковке с подтверждениями:
Переименовывать автом.
Переим. автом. сушеств.

Разное:
Оставлять на диске повреждённые файлы


Настройки - Explorer integration
Enable individual commands
или сделать вызов отдельного окна с этими настройками
или сделать эти настройки в "окне" с полосой прокруткой
Автор: Bulat_Ziganshin
Дата сообщения: 05.06.2009 17:44

Цитата:
Разное:
Оставлять на диске повреждённые файлы


Настройки - Explorer integration
Enable individual commands
или сделать вызов отдельного окна с этими настройками
или сделать эти настройки в "окне" с полосой прокруткой

сделал


Цитата:
Переименовывать автом.
Переим. автом. сушеств.

в чём между ними разница?

Добавлено:
ах да, ты наверно имеешь в виду переименовать или файл с диска или файл из архива
Автор: egor23
Дата сообщения: 05.06.2009 17:58
Bulat_Ziganshin

Цитата:
в чём между ними разница?

Переименовывать автом. - переименовывается распаковываемый файл
Переим. автом. сушеств. - файл на диске переименовывается
Автор: slech
Дата сообщения: 06.06.2009 09:28

может лучше переназвать пунк меню
Add to ... --> Add to archive ...


ещё вопросик про основное окно при архивации, предолгаю к нему вернуться когда будут выполнены более важные задачи.



у WinRar и 7zip окна поделены на 2-е части и это нагляднее, проще найти то что необходимо.
Автор: Bulat_Ziganshin
Дата сообщения: 06.06.2009 15:25

Цитата:
Add to ... --> Add to archive ...

сделал

Добавлено:

Цитата:
у WinRar и 7zip окна поделены на 2-е части и это нагляднее, проще найти то что необходимо.

http://code.google.com/p/freearc/issues/detail?id=88
Автор: juvaforza
Дата сообщения: 06.06.2009 15:52
Bulat_Ziganshin
Можно вас попросить History.txt перекодировать в UTF-8?
Автор: Bulat_Ziganshin
Дата сообщения: 06.06.2009 16:03

Цитата:
Можно вас попросить History.txt перекодировать в UTF-8?

если речь про файл в SVN - то нет, если в дистрибутах - то да
Автор: PAQer
Дата сообщения: 06.06.2009 20:07
Bulat_Ziganshin
Создан архив и надо в нем переименовать один файл. Это реально?
Автор: Bulat_Ziganshin
Дата сообщения: 06.06.2009 20:29
нет
Автор: egor23
Дата сообщения: 06.06.2009 20:58
Bulat_Ziganshin

Цитата:
нет

а планируется?
Автор: Bulat_Ziganshin
Дата сообщения: 06.06.2009 21:12
egor23
http://code.google.com/p/freearc/issues/detail?id=89

Добавлено:

Цитата:
не хватает опций в явном виде:
Перезапись:
Переименовывать автом.
Переим. автом. сушеств.

http://code.google.com/p/freearc/issues/detail?id=90
Автор: juvaforza
Дата сообщения: 06.06.2009 22:39
Bulat_Ziganshin
Об svn речь, но можно и в дистрибутиве.

Цитата:
то нет

Просто удобно будет смотреть через SF содержание файла, сейчас русские символы не читаемы в данной кодировке. Знаете, все люди немножко ленивые... я думаю, это положительно повлияет на статистику скачивания


Цитата:
поделены на 2-е части

Гм, скорее поделены не на две части, а на зоны по назначению.

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051

Предыдущая тема: Universal Share Downloader (USD)


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.